What is a Ruland Manufacturing balanced shaft collar used for?
A Ruland Manufacturing balanced shaft collar is used to secure components on a shaft without marring the surface. Its 2-piece clamp-on design provides high holding power and precise positioning in industrial machinery, conveyors, and automation systems where balance and minimal runout are critical.
What are the specifications of the Ruland MSPB-12-A shaft collar?
The Ruland MSPB-12-A is a metric, round, 2-piece clamp-on balanced shaft collar with a 12 mm bore diameter. It is made from 2024 aluminum, offering a lightweight yet strong solution for high-speed applications. The part number is MSPB-12-A.

How to install a 2-piece clamp-on shaft collar?
To install a 2-piece clamp-on shaft collar, first clean the shaft and collar bore. Place the collar halves around the shaft, align the screws, and tighten them evenly in a cross pattern to the manufacturer's recommended torque. This ensures secure clamping without damaging the shaft.
